Site of the crash of MiG-29 fighter aircraft into the Black sea was established, search for black box continues

The location where a Bulgarian Air Force MiG-29 fighter aircraft crashed in the Black Sea in the early hours of June 9 during a nighttime training exercise has been confirmed.

Debris from the crashed aircraft is scattered across a large area on the sea bed. The black box has not been found, Commander of the Navy, Rear Admiral Kiril Mihailov, told a briefing for the media on June 17.

The plane shattered into thousands of small pieces. Hopes to find a larger part that could be easily taken out later, and to remove the black box from it, were dashed, Rear Admiral Kiril Mihailov said.

The MiG-29 fighter jet went down into the sea 18 kilometres away from Cape Shabla. Parts of the landing gear and the engine were found at great depth. The search for the plane's black box continues.

In the collision with the sea surface, the plane broke into thousands of small pieces. Some of the remains of the MiG-29 fighter were found on a large area of ​​the seabed. Sea waves in the area of ​​the plane crash allowed the search for the black box to continue.

Specialists on board the minesweeper "Tsibar". are currently surveying the area and all the remains are being carefully examined by remote-controlled underwater inspection devices.

"But our goal is not to lift anything from the bottom, our goal is to find the black box," said Rear Admiral Kiril Mihailov, commander of the Navy.

The search operation is on an area of one square kilometre and more than 70 m deep in the sea

"It's like looking for a needle in a haystack. So the probability of finding it is very, very small, which doesn't stop us from continuing the search," Rear Admiral Kiril Mihailov added.

In an emotional post on Facebook a few days ago, the wife of the deceased pilot Valentin Terziev defended his professional skills, emphasizing that according to her, on the fatal night the flight of the fighter aircraft was conducted all the time with a number of mistakes. According to Reserve General Spas Spasov, chairman of the Bulgarian Air Force Foundation, the dead pilot's wife has the right to ask questions, but is convinced the truth will not be hidden.

"This is difficult, because the plane crash often leaves a lot of questions and it is not possible to get to the real thing that caused this crash," Spasov said.

The search for the black box and the wreckage will continue until they are found. The Navy has the necessary equipment and it is not necessary to seek help from other countries, Rear Admiral Mihailov added.

The search and rescue operation of Major Valentin Terziev started immediately after the tragic incident. It lasted until 10 a.m. on June 10, when it became clear that the pilot could not be found and that if he had ejected, he would have been saved.

The next stage of the search operation started. Parts of the plane's equipment were found, which were removed from the water surface and handed over to the Military Prosecutor's Office, which has launched an investigation. Then biological material was discovered.

The operation involved 4 ships from the Navy, 2 helicopters, 3 cutters, a total of 260 people from the Navy and 21 people from the border police.

The search for the remains of the machine was resumed today. It was suspended earlier in the week due to bad weather conditions.

***

A Bulgarian Air Force MiG-29 crashed into the Black Sea in the early hours of June 9 while taking part in the Shabla 21 training exercise. The plane crashed in the open sea near Shabla

Bulgaria’s Ministry of Defence said on June 10 said that during the search operation it was found that the pilot of the fighter aircraft, Major Valentin Terziev, died on June 9 during the training exercise for shooting at an air target (illuminated parachute target) at night.
